Why Curtain Tracks Are Different from Curtain Rods
To begin with, we should better define our terms. A curtain track is an inconspicuous rail system, using aluminum or plastic, and gliders or carriers on hooks. Basically, you conceal it under a pelmet or valance made from fabric. A curtain rod, on the other hand, is a showy pole placed on brackets and designed to be viewed. The distinction between a curtain rod and a curtain track is more than a matter of designing one over the other; it’s about finding a solution for a given problem. Ceiling-mounted solutions have a distinct advantage over wall-mounted ones in this sense.
Main Reasons for Ceiling-Mounted Curtain Tracks
It helps you to appreciate why this installation technique has become popular for such kinds of projects. In this context, below are the major reasons for taking into consideration a ceiling track system.
1. For Rooms with Irregular or Non-Existent Walls
This is the most convincing and practical reason for understanding when to install ceiling-mounted curtain tracks. Do you have floor-to-ceiling glass walls, a wall of sliding doors, a sunroom that contains most of its area in glass rather than solid wall surfaces, and possibly windows that sit in deep recessed areas? In that case, there is no place for a common wall-fixed rod to go. The advantage of mounting the curtain track right to the ceiling is that it gives a strong anchor point that doesn’t require the wall to support it.
2. To Create an Illusion of Height
Designers will often incorporate this design trick in a room to make it seem larger. One of the ways they accomplish this is by installing a track right along the ceiling, then hanging curtains right on top. It raises your eye up. While it may seem a bit strange, it is extremely effective in creating a room with height since it produces a full straight line of fabric going all the way up to the ceiling. It is a great approach for a room with low ceilings.
3. To Achieve a Modern, Minimalist Aesthetic
However, if you have a modern or a Scandinavian style in mind for your interior design, you should opt for a ceiling track. The design in itself is sleek and unobtrusive. Moreover, if you pair this particular design with a simple cap or a track with a color matching that of the ceiling or go for a color that blends with the colors on your ceiling, this design will render the track completely invisible. The spotlight will thus remain on the beautiful fabric.
4. To Support Heavy or Layered Window Treatments
Functionality-wise, ceiling tracks are workhorses too. They are miraculously strong with substantial weight-carrying capacity. Are you considering combining sheer curtains with blackout curtains? Do these blackout curtains consist of exceptionally heavy and lined fabrics? A heavy-duty ceiling track system with multiple gliders and sturdy ceiling fixings will not only handle such weight easily but will also not droop even if laden with weight. This makes them highly superior to other systems for master bedrooms, home theaters, and living rooms alike.
5. For Perfect Operation Around Bays and Corners
The biggest advantage of these tracks is in negotiating a curve in bay windows or simply going around a corner in a continuous motion. Tracks are made in a flexible manner that can be bent in a shape to accommodate a specific bay window exactly. Even corners of 90 or 180 degrees can be negotiated in a smooth motion using corner connectors. This further strengthens the point that one specific window treatment can flow around the entire wall of windows in a house in a seamless motion that’s not possible in a rigid rod system. This is a specialty use of ceiling-mounted curtain tracks.
Before Installation
Well, now that you are fired up about the potential that is available, there are several key considerations that need to be covered for the effective implementation of the technology.

1. Evaluation of Your Ceiling Design: This is the first and the most essential step. The installation of the track should necessarily be done on the wooden joists or concrete ceiling. Hammering on plaster or drywall will surely result in a disastrous collapse. The professional will employ the use of a stud finder or his knowledge in identifying the secure spots.
2. Accurate Measurement is Everything: In order to accurately measure the width of tracks that will be laid, there has to be consideration of any overlaps that must be created in the center or stacked back at the end. In cases of layered layouts, there may be requirements for double and even triple tracks.
3. Choosing the Right Track System: Factors include weight capacity and the type of gliders available for quiet operation, as well as options for a drawcord, wand, or motorized track system. A motorized ceiling track represents the ultimate in added convenience and luxurious living.
4. Professional installation is highly recommended because of the requirements of finding joists in the ceiling, aligning appropriately, and likely complex corners. It is not the kind of DIY activity that one who is learning would undertake.
Room-by-Room Applications in Your Home
What kind of real-world application can we relate this to? Where will this work best in your residence?
- Living Room, Dining Room: Even those with sliding doors to balconies are using ceiling track systems, which can use full-width curtains to create a framed view.
- Master Bedrooms: For an indulgent, hotel-like look using sheers and blackouts. Ceiling-mounted to hold the weight of the fabrics while also providing light control.
- Bay Windows: The traditional use. The ceiling rod is curved to mirror the shape of the window, enabling the curtains to be swathed to either side.
- Studios & Open-Plan Rooms: To create defined areas without the use of walls. A ceiling track allows you to create a floor-to-ceiling curtain to distinguish a sleeping area from a living area.
- Rooms with Radiators or Furniture under Windows: The curtain just hangs right in front of the obstruction, thanks to being placed on the ceiling, which prevents any untidy folds over radiators or furniture.

FAQs Regarding When to Use Ceiling-Mounted Curtain Tracks
1. Are ceiling tracks costlier compared to wall-based rods?
First of all, there may be a higher starting cost in terms of the track system and its installation; however, they are more durable and offer more strength to the fabrics in terms of weight and are capable of coping with architectural issues beyond rod solutions.
2. Can I install a ceiling track by myself?
Although it’s possible if you’re a very skilled DIY person and have all the necessary tools, we would definitely recommend against it. It is very important to locate ceiling joists accurately and align them perfectly, and then mount the rail strongly enough to support heavy curtains.
3. Are ceiling tracks suitable for all types of curtains?
Yes, indeed. They are really very adaptable. You can use them with pinch pleat, eyelet, tab top, or wave fold curtains using the respective gliders and hooks. These rods work very well for achieving equal and elegant pleats, even for a wide span.
4. If the track is located on the ceiling, how can I or should I clean or access the windows?
This is a critical planning consideration. Make sure your track is long enough out from the window on both sides such that, when the curtains are fully pulled back, they are completely out of the glass area.
5. Can ceiling tracks be motorized?
Absolutely. In fact, ceiling tracks work best with motorization. It is possible to incorporate the motor in a way that allows you to control heavy or hard-to-reach curtains using a remote, a switch, and even a smart home system. This brings in a whole lot of convenience.
